if you're doing shape tweens you need to start playing with shape hints.
These give you a point which you snap to a point at the start of the tween
and then there's a matching one where you'd like that point to finish at the
end of the tween.

I warn you now - you should do a step and if you like the results duplicate
the timeline to keep a backup and keep on working like that because shape
tweens get really out of hand, really quickly
